Hypertension is a prevalent condition among older adults and is associated with serious complications, including cardiovascular disease, stroke, and renal failure. Non-pharmacological interventions, particularly the use of functional foods, have gained increasing attention due to their natural benefits and minimal adverse effects. This case study aimed to evaluate the effect of daily watermelon juice consumption on blood pressure in a 61 year old woman with a history of hypertension residing in Dusun Walahir Tonggoh, Welasari Village, Majalengka Regency. The patient received 300 mL of freshly prepared watermelon juice once daily for four consecutive days. Nursing care was delivered using the nursing process, including assessment, diagnosis, intervention, implementation, and evaluation. Blood pressure was measured before and after the intervention using a manual sphygmomanometer. The results demonstrated a clinically meaningful reduction in blood pressure, from an average of 155/90 mmHg to 140/80 mmHg, indicating the potential effectiveness of watermelon juice in lowering blood pressure. This study concludes that watermelon juice may serve as a promising, natural, and affordable complementary therapy to support hypertension management in elderly patients.

This study examines the representation of moral values in Hikayat Prabu Anom Volume 2 through the lens of Immanuel Kant’s deontological ethics. The analysis focuses on three main categories of moral values: divine moral values, social moral values, and personal moral values. The method used is descriptive qualitative with content analysis techniques applied to selected passages in the text that reflect ethical dimensions. The data is analyzed by identifying the actions and dialogues of central characters that embody moral principles such as duty, goodwill, and moral autonomy. The findings reveal that divine moral values are reflected in the characters’ submission to divine will and their sincere devotion through spiritual practices such as meditation and worship. Social moral values are evident in the just and wise actions of Prabu Anom, who shows concern for his people, honors the service of royal officials, and nurtures familial ties with fellow rulers. Meanwhile, personal moral values emerge through emotional self-control, consistency in principles, and the courage and responsibility demonstrated by the characters in times of conflict. The study concludes that Hikayat Prabu Anom Volume 2 is not only a heroic narrative but also a literary work rich in ethical values that align with universal moral principles and remain relevant in contemporary life.

Background: Hypertension (high blood pressure) remains a very serious public health problem, a major disease burden, and one of the leading causes of premature death worldwide, including in Indonesia. Data shows that 59.1% of disabilities (seeing, hearing, walking) in the population aged 15 years and over are acquired diseases, of which 53.5% are non-communicable diseases, primarily hypertension (22.2%). Socializing the importance of a healthy lifestyle, early detection, and the provision of quality health services to the community to control hypertension. Activities and programs focus on human resource development, integration of all systems/applications within SATU SEHAT, community empowerment, and support for innovative research. Purpose: To increase knowledge about hypertension and complementary therapies to lower blood pressure using boiled bay leaf water. Method: This community service activity was conducted on February 17, 2025, in the hall of the Carebbu Village Office, Awampone District, Bone Regency. Twelve elderly people with hypertension participated as respondents. Educational material was delivered through lectures and leaflets. A questionnaire was used to measure respondents' knowledge before and after the educational activity (pre-test) and after the educational activity (post-test). The level of knowledge was evaluated by comparing the scores before the educational activity (pre-test) with the scores after the educational activity (post-test). Results: The health education program went well. Five respondents (41.7%) had good knowledge about hypertension before the education session, five respondents (41.7%) had sufficient knowledge, and two respondents (16.6%) had poor knowledge. After the educational session, the number of respondents with good knowledge increased to 10 (83.4%), and two respondents (16.6%) had sufficient knowledge. Conclusion: Community service activities involving education on blood pressure-lowering therapy using boiled bay leaves have proven effective in increasing the knowledge of hypertension sufferers in managing their condition. This increased knowledge contributes positively to their psychological well-being and boosts their self-confidence in adopting a healthy lifestyle with natural, easy, and affordable therapy. After the Padri War (1803-1837), Tuanku Imam Bondjol was exiled by the Dutch colonial government to Minahasa and Manado. During his exile in Manado, his son, Naali Sutan Caniago, who accompanied Tuanku Imam Bondjol during his exile, wrote a manuscript about his father's struggle. This manuscript is called the Tambo Tuanku Imam Bondjol Manuscript, which is a single manuscript (codex unicus). In general, this manuscript contains a summary of the history of the Padri War in West Sumatra in the 19th century. It contains Tuanku Imam Bondjol's memoirs, his thoughts, and notes on the Padri war. In this study, the Tambo Tuanku Imam Bondjol manuscript is examined using philological and historical methods. This manuscript has been transliterated and translated by Safnir Abu Naim, However, this study will trace the philological stages carried out on the Tambo Tuanku Imam Bondjol manuscript to demonstrate its originality and authenticity. The problem examined in this study is how the Tambo Tuanku Imam Bondjol manuscript stands as a historical source of the Padri War. To that end, a textual study of the translation of the manuscript was conducted using the Critical Discourse Analysis (CDA) method modeled by Teun A. Van Dijk. This study also uses the Historical Method with the ultimate goal of compiling a historiography of the struggle of Tuanku Imam Bondjol and the Padri War. From the results of the study, it is concluded that the Tambo Tuanku Imam Bondjol manuscript is an authentic source of the Padri War, a first-hand historical source originating from indigenous records. Before the discovery of this manuscript, sources for the Padri War were generally only from colonial archives.
